Tony Gabard is a scholar working on Atmospheric Science, Spectroscopy and Global and Planetary Change. According to data from OpenAlex, Tony Gabard has authored 20 papers receiving a total of 488 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Atmospheric Science, 18 papers in Spectroscopy and 14 papers in Global and Planetary Change. Recurrent topics in Tony Gabard’s work include Spectroscopy and Laser Applications (18 papers), Atmospheric Ozone and Climate (18 papers) and Atmospheric and Environmental Gas Dynamics (14 papers). Tony Gabard is often cited by papers focused on Spectroscopy and Laser Applications (18 papers), Atmospheric Ozone and Climate (18 papers) and Atmospheric and Environmental Gas Dynamics (14 papers). Tony Gabard collaborates with scholars based in France, United States and Russia. Tony Gabard's co-authors include J.P. Champion, Vincent Boudon, C. Brodbeck, Frédéric Chaussard, Nguyen‐Van‐Thanh, R. Saint‐Loup, Robert R. Gamache, C. Claveau, Dionisio Bermejo and J.‐M. Hartmann and has published in prestigious journals such as The Journal of Chemical Physics, Physical review. B. and Journal of Molecular Spectroscopy.
